NVIDIA's DLSS 5: A Leap Towards Photorealistic Gaming

NVIDIA's latest innovation, DLSS 5, is set to revolutionize the gaming industry by bridging the gap between rendering and reality. This technology, unveiled at the GTC keynote, introduces a real-time neural rendering model that infuses pixels with photorealistic lighting and materials, marking a significant breakthrough in computer graphics.

One thing that immediately stands out is the industry support for DLSS 5. Major publishers and developers, including Bethesda, CAPCOM, and Ubisoft, are on board, recognizing the technology's potential to elevate visual fidelity. This widespread adoption is a strong indicator of DLSS 5's impact on the gaming landscape.
